OLD PROSPECT

The Old Prospect and Maguires workings are located on or adjacent to a series of sub parallel NNW and NW trending second order structural splays located to the west of the regional Dalgaranga-Big Bell Shear corridor. Old Prospect mineralisation extends over at least 650 metres of strike and is located within a 5km long zone of mineralisation extending from Cap Lamp to Middle Bore that is open along strike to the north and south.

Historic exploration was completed by BHP, Posgold and OZZ consisting of RAB, Reverse Circulation (RC) and Diamond drilling. Significant intercepts include:

  • 8m @ 8.78 g/t Au from 41m, including 2m @ 30.8 (BWRC006)
  • 8m @ 7.98 g/t Au from 9m, including 1m @ 32.4 and 1m @ 19.9 (BWRC020)
  • 7m @ 9.10 g/t Au from 81m, including 1m @ 56.1 (21MRRC011)
  • 15m @ 2.51 g/t Au from 45m (21MRRC003)
  • 19m @ 1.72 g/t Au from 114m, including 1m @ 21.1 (JBD001)
  • 8m @ 3.97 g/t Au from 46m, including 1m @ 20.2 (21MRRC032)
  • 15m @ 2.09 g/t Au from 26m, including 1m @ 13.8 (BWRC004)
  • 10m @ 2.48 g/t Au from 100m (21MRRC039)
  • 18m @ 1.32 g/t Au from 28m (21MRRC011)
  • 4m @ 5.48 g/t Au from 8m, including 1m @ 12.8 (BWRC005)

Planned Activities

Exploration work will recommence across Scorpion’s tenements early in the January quarter, the key areas of focus will include:

  • Infill and extension RC drilling at Old Prospect
  • Definition of an Exploration Target
  • Mining studies and an application to convert Old Prospect tenements to a mining lease
  • Diamond drilling to test the mineralisation down plunge at depth and collect material for geotechnical/metallurgical assessment/test work.
  • Follow-up RC drilling of selected regional targets – approx. 1500 metres
  • Detailed (1:5000 scale) geological mapping
